A Tail of Darkness to Light: How Tater Helped Dave Overcome Addiction and Find Purpose
By Kenneth Thomas
In a heartfelt journey of resilience and redemption, A Tail of Darkness to Light follows Dave, a man who finds himself at rock bottom, gripped by addiction and haunted by his past. Set against the tranquil yet challenging backdrop of rural Arkansas, this memoir reveals how hope can emerge from the darkest of places when least expected. For Dave, salvation arrives in the form of two scruffy, spirited dogs-Tater, a calm and steady service dog with a golden heart, and his lively, playful companion, Porkchop. Together, they offer Dave not only companionship but the will to confront his inner struggles and rebuild his life, one step at a time.
Through their daily routines-quiet mornings in the misty woods, evening walks that offer moments of clarity, and even Tater's unwavering presence during sleepless nights-Dave discovers the grounding force of loyalty, patience, and unconditional love. As Tater and Porkchop help him face the difficult path of sobriety, they pull him out of despair and guide him toward something he never expected to find: purpose.
Rediscovering a passion for writing, Dave begins to tell his story, finding new meaning in becoming an advocate for others in recovery. He realizes that his journey, though personal, resonates deeply with countless others who have faced addiction, loss, and self-doubt. His words, inspired by the animals who saved him, become a beacon of hope for those still struggling.
This moving story of healing and companionship is a powerful reminder that, no matter how far one falls, redemption is possible. Through the bond with his dogs and the lessons of loyalty and resilience they embody, Dave learns to embrace a new life of meaning, peace, and purpose.
A Tail of Darkness to Light speaks to the power of love, the strength found in friendship, and the healing that comes from facing life's battles head-on. It's a story that will resonate with anyone who has ever needed a second chance, and a reminder that sometimes, the path to recovery begins with the simple act of letting someone-or some loyal dogs-walk beside you
